Bugsey's ear is better.  Unfortunately it is not healed.  It is definately
an allergy thing.  He developed allergies to several more grasses this past
year and while we have started him on shots for those, he is not up to the
"final" dose yet.  So, he is on a low dose of prednisone every other day
and posatex in his ear every day.  The posatex has a local steroid as well
as anti-yeast and antibacterial properties to keep the open sores from
becoming infected.  Hopefully we can get him off the pred when grass season
is over.  If not, we will re-evaluate the plan.  I really don't want him on
pred, year round.

Beauford is doing pretty good this grass season.  This gives me hope for
Bugsey.  Beauford has been on the shots a year longer.  Gee, he is a year
older.  I really see a difference between this year and last year.  He
doesn't get the ear infections like Bugsey.  He gets a rash on his
underside and then scratches it open.  No rash at all this year and we just
have him on hydroxazine and pred eye drops as needed, plus his allergy
shots.
